Jika Anda menjalankan aplikasi web menggunakan teknologi ASP asli pada Windows Server 2003, Anda mungkin mendapatkan pesan kesalahan ini setelah Anda meningkatkan ke Paket Layanan 2: “Transaksi baru tidak dapat terdaftar di koordinator transaksi yang ditentukan. [-2147168246] ”.
Penyebab untuk kesalahan ini adalah bahwa MSDTC memiliki pengaturan yang memerlukan otentikasi untuk transaksi terdistribusi, dan upgrade ke SP2 mungkin mengubah pengaturan ke diperlukan, bukan tidak ada.
Untuk memperbaiki kesalahan ini, buka Layanan Komponen dan klik kanan pada ikon My Computer dan pilih properti.
Pilih tab MSDTC dan kemudian di bagian bawah jendela klik tombol Keamanan Konfigurasi.
Di jendela ini, ubah pengaturan di bawah Transaction Manager Communication menjadi "No Authentication Required".
Ini harus menyelesaikan kesalahan ini.
Perhatikan bahwa jika Anda memiliki firewall antara server web dan server basis data maka Anda harus memastikan bahwa port tinggi terbuka di antara dua mesin, bersama dengan RPC, karena itu juga bisa menyebabkan kesalahan yang sama.